Athletics Overview
Purdue Fort Wayne competes in NCAA Division I, where athletic scholarships and serious competition define the sports culture. The Mastodons field 16 varsity teams with 284 total athletes, representing just 5.2% of the 5,450-student body. The school awards $2.56 million in athletic scholarships across its programs. As a member of the Summit League, not the Big Ten as some data suggests, the Mastodons focus on building their Division I identity after the campus split from IPFW in 2018. The relatively new athletic program lacks the deep traditions of established Division I schools, but students can still experience the excitement of high-level college sports. The small percentage of student-athletes means most students engage with athletics as spectators rather than participants in the competitive program.
